The Marchesi Di Barolo Barolo Grande Annata from the esteemed 1967 vintage is a remarkable red wine that beautifully showcases the Nebbiolo varietal. Originating from the renowned Barolo region, this wine exhibits a captivating deep garnet hue, hinting at its age and complexity. On the palate, it offers an exquisite full-bodied experience, complemented by bright acidity that lends vibrancy to its profile. The fruit intensity is pronounced, delivering layers of dark cherry, plum, and subtle hints of dried rose petals. The tannins are notably firm, contributing to its exceptional structure and longevity, making it an embodiment of elegance. This wine is decidedly dry, creating a sophisticated balance that invites contemplation and makes it an exquisite choice for special occasions. With its rich heritage and diligent craftsmanship, this Barolo exemplifies the artistry of fine winemaking, offering a taste of history in every sip.

While France takes the crown for the most famous wines styles and grape varieties, Italy is where wine was first perfected. The ancient Greeks called it Oenotria—"land of the vines"—and the Roman Empire advanced grape growing and winemaking to a level of quality we still enjoy today. But behind Italy's best-known wines, such as Chianti, Barolo and prosecco, there's an almost endless diversity of delights awaiting the intrepid explorer. The key to understanding Italian wine is regionality and (of course) food. From the aromatic and sparkling whites of the north to Sicily's rich and spicy reds, Italy offers wine lovers a lifetime of gastronomic treats.
